Question 1

What does María buy?

María entra en la panadería. Compra una barra de pan caliente y dice gracias al dependiente antes de salir.

English gloss: María enters the bakery. She buys a loaf of hot bread and thanks the clerk before leaving.

Question 2

Why does Pablo cancel the walk?

Llueve mucho, así que Pablo cancela la caminata y llama a su hermana para reorganizar la tarde.

English gloss: It rains a lot, so Pablo cancels the walk and calls his sister to reschedule the afternoon.

Question 3

How late is the train?

El tren llega tarde veinte minutos. Los pasajeros esperan en silencio mirando los paneles electrónicos.

English gloss: The train arrives twenty minutes late. Passengers wait in silence looking at the electronic boards.

Question 4

When does the new book arrive?

La bibliotecaria recuerda que el libro nuevo llegará mañana y guarda una copia para Ana si promete devolverlo a tiempo.

English gloss: The librarian remembers that the new book arrives tomorrow and saves a copy for Ana if she promises to return it on time.

Question 5

What guides their spending decision?

Durante la reunión, el equipo admite que el presupuesto es estrecho pero decide invertir solo en mejoras que los usuarios pidieron.

English gloss: During the meeting, the team admits the budget is tight but decides to invest only in improvements users requested.

Question 6

Why prefer local herbs?

El chef insiste en usar hierbas locales porque quiere que el menú refleje la temporada sin copiar recetas demasiado conocidas.

English gloss: The chef insists on using local herbs because they want the menu to reflect the season without copying overly familiar recipes.

Question 7

What does the irregular signature imply?

Aunque la carta parece formal, la firma irregular sugiere que alguien la escribió con prisa frente al consulado cerrado.

English gloss: Although the letter seems formal, the irregular signature suggests someone wrote it in haste in front of the closed consulate.

Question 8

What condition does the mayor attach?

La alcaldesa propone peatonalizar una calle conflictiva si los vecinos aceptan turnos voluntarios para vigilar las terrazas por las noches.

English gloss: The mayor proposes pedestrianizing a contested street if neighbors accept voluntary shifts to watch the terraces at night.

Question 9

How does the novel handle conflict?

El crítico admira cómo la novela evita melodrama: cada confrontación corta revela culpa compartida sin declarar un villano único.

English gloss: The critic admires how the novel avoids melodrama: each brief confrontation reveals shared guilt without declaring a single villain.

Question 10

How do engineers view the model?

Los ingenieros reconocen que el modelo simplifica demasiado la erosión costera, pero lo defienden como punto de partida para sensibilizar al público.

English gloss: The engineers admit the model oversimplifies coastal erosion but defend it as a starting point to raise public awareness.
